This works 100%. Four years using two frog logs in a very large pool, and not a single floater, whereas before the frog logs, there used to be regular casualties (chipmunks, mice, small rabbits etc). You can use dive weights inside the weight pocket instead of sand for extra stability, or even just put a rock or small brick over the flat pocket. They're super durable too. I just do a thorough clean every fall, but there's never been a hole and it doesn't even seem to lose air. In four years, I've only had to add air twice. Highly recommended.
